## Formula sandbox tuning

User-supplied formulas in Gridmoor execute inside a restricted interpreter with hard ceilings on time, memory, and call depth. Reviewers should confirm any change to these ceilings is justified in the PR description, since raising them widens the abuse surface. Defaults were chosen from production traces. The current limits are as follows.

limits module of tafog-fawip:
WEIGHTS = {
    "julix": 57,
    "lamys": 992,
    "kasvan": 209,
    "quenok": 750,
    "alddor": 259,
    "oliath": 1009,
    "wenix": 815,
}

Subject: Quickstore 4.2 — bloom filter now fronts the KV layer

Plugin authors: starting with this release, Quickstore places a bloom filter ahead of the key-value store. Negative lookups return faster; false positives fall through safely. No API changes are required on your side. Verify your plugin against the staging build referenced below.

session token of fahif-tadup = htk3_9c7

Subject: FleetGlide Fuel-Usage Report — build ready for plugin validation

Hello plugin authors,

The revised fleet fuel-usage report in FleetGlide now aggregates per-vehicle consumption hourly instead of daily, which changes the export payload shape your plugins consume. Please validate against the staging feed before Thursday's cutover and confirm your parsers tolerate the new nested depot summaries. If anything looks off, reply in this channel and quote the trace token that follows.

session token of kageg-tahop = htk14_af3c1ccccb7dcf

[ ] Websocket reconnect bug in Pulsewire still needs a once-over. Heads up: clients stuck in a reconnect loop after idle timeouts keep paging us at 3am, and the backoff logic in the Glimmerbay gateway looks sketchy. Verify the jitter fix actually landed in prod before closing this out. If it flares up again tonight, escalate straight to the owner of record.

named custodian: Fraion Holael

Welcome to the Cartbound team. The pick-list optimizer batches warehouse orders into walking routes, recalculated every five minutes against live bin inventory. As a contractor you will mostly touch the route-scoring module; please avoid editing the bin-sync service without a review. The full architecture walkthrough and test harness guide are on the internal page below.

dashboard of bafof-hafog = https://confluence.lumiclabs.internal/display/browse/display/6a09a20a